2018—2021年COVID-19疫情前后国内18家血液中心红细胞成分血供应情况分析  被引量:3

Analysis of red blood cells supply before and after the outbreak of COVID-19 from 2018 to 2021 in 18 domestic blood centers

摘  要:目的对2018—2021年新型冠状病毒感染(COVID-19)前后国内18家血液中心红细胞成分血供应相关数据进行比较分析。方法采用回顾性研究方法,收集2018—2021年国内18家血液中心红细胞成分血供应相关的8个数据,包括合格红细胞成分血入库总量(简称入库总量)、红细胞成分血发放总量(简称发放总量)、每千人口红细胞成分血发放量(简称每千人口发放量)、每千人口400 mL全血制备的红细胞成分血发放量[简称每千人口发放量(400 mL)]、红细胞成分血日均发放量(简称日均发放量)、红细胞成分血日均库存量(简称日均库存量)、发放时红细胞成分血平均天数(简称红细胞天数)、红细胞成分血过期量(简称过期量)。根据COVID-19发生时间,2018、2019年数据为疫情爆发前组,2020、2021年数据为疫情爆发后组。结果2018—2021年18家血液中心红细胞成分血供应相关数据,疫情前组与疫情后组比较,每千人口发放量(中位数14.68 U>13.92 U)、每千人口发放量(400 mL)(中位数10.16 U>9.21 U)减少,差异有统计学意义(P<0.05);2019、2020年数据比较,发放总量(中位数117770.38 U>99084.08 U)、每千人口发放量(中位数15.04 U>12.19 U)、每千人口发放量(400 mL)(中位数10.11 U>8.94 U)、日均发放量(中位数322.66 U>270.73 U)减少,红细胞天数(中位数10.50 d<11.45 d)增加,差异有统计学意义(P<0.05);2020、2021年数据比较,入库总量(中位数101920.25 U<120328.63 U)、发放总量(中位数99084.08 U<118428.62 U)、每千人口发放量(中位数12.19 U<15.00 U)、每千人口发放量(400 mL)(中位数8.94 U<9.46 U)、日均发放量(中位数270.73 U>324.46 U)、日均库存量(中位数3222.00 U<4328.00 U)增加,过期量(中位数1.50 U>0.00 U)减少,差异有统计学意义(P<0.05)。方差分析结果显示,不同采供血机构的红细胞成分血供应相关数据(除过期量外)存在显著差异(P<0.05);日均库存量与日均发放量之比疫情爆发后�Objective To compare the supply data of red blood cells(RBCs)from 18 blood centers in China before and after the outbreak of COVID-19 during 2018 to 2021.Methods Eight indicators related to RBCs supply from 18 blood centers in China during 2018-2021 were collected retrospectively,including the storage of total amount of qualified RBCs(referred to as the total amount of storage),the distribution of total amount of RBCs(referred to as the total amount of distribution),the distribution amount of RBCs per 1000 population(referred to as the amount of distribution per 1000 population),the distribution amount of RBCs from 400 mL original blood per 1000 population[referred to as the amount of distribution per 1000 population(400 mL)],the average daily distribution amount of RBCs(referred to as the average daily distribution amount),the average daily storage amount of RBCs(referred to as the average daily storage amount),the average storage days of RBCs when distribute(referred to as the RBC storage days),and the expired amount of RBCs(referred to as the expired amount).Based on the outbreak time of COVID-19,the data of 2018 and 2019 were the pre-pandemic group,and the data of 2020 and 2021 were the post-pandemic group.Results Data on RBCs supply in 18 blood centers from 2018 to 2021(comparison of the pre-pandemic group and the post-pandemic group):the amount of distribution per 1000 population(median 14.68 U>13.92 U)decreased,the amount of distribution per 1000 population(400 mL)(median 10.16 U>9.21 U)decreased,and the difference was statistically significant(P<0.05);data comparison between 2019 and 2020:the total amount of distribution(median 117770.38 U>99084.08 U)decreased,the amount of distribution per 1000 population(median 15.04 U>12.19 U)decreased,the amount of distribution per 1000 population(400 mL)(median 10.11 U>8.94 U),the average daily distribution amount(322.66 U>270.73 U)decreased and RBC storage days(median 10.50 d<11.45 d)increased,the difference has statistical significance(P<0.05);data comparison betwe
